Curtiss Motorcycle Co. Unveils Its First, and Last Bike of the Past 100 Years – The Warhawk
Curtiss Motorcycle Co. used to be called Confederate Motors, however they have rebranded themselves for obvious reasons and are on a new path moving forward. The company has just unveiled the first, and last, V-Twin motorcycle they’ll be building before making the switch to exclusively manufacturing electric motorcycles in the future. Below you will find a picture of their radical Warhawk, of which only 35 will be made. Check it out!
Begin Press Release:
BIRMINGHAM, AL ? February 20, 2018 ? For the first time in over 100 years, a new Curtiss Motorcycle is hitting the streets. Sharing a name with its famous World War II fighter plane ancestor, the new Warhawk pays homage to the man who invented the first American V-Twin motorcycle ? Glenn Curtiss. The announcement marks the first product release since Confederate Motors rebranded to Curtiss Motorcycle earlier this year.
?We?ve spent the past 27 years working to optimize and perfect Mr. Curtiss?s V-Twin invention,? explained Curtiss CEO Matt Chambers. ?Everything we know is built into this machine. Because the Warhawk is based on our acclaimed P51 Fighter, the engine, powertrain, and chassis are as solid as a bank vault. But now, we?ve cranked it to 11. There are no more rabbits we can pull out of the proverbial hat. There?s simply no way to make a more explosive hot-rod American V-twin than the Curtiss Warhawk.?
